Job Summary
The Senior Executive - Accounts Payable is responsible for managing day-to-day invoice processing, vendor payments, and account reconciliations in line with company policies and financial controls. This role ensures accurate and timely payment cycles, maintains positive vendor relationships, and supports month-end closing activities. The Senior Executive also assists in resolving discrepancies, preparing reports, and contributing to continuous process improvements within the AP function.
Key Responsibilities
1. Invoice Processing
- Review invoices from vendors and verify that invoices are accurate, properly coded, and approved for payment.
- Enter invoices into the accounting system for processing.
2. Payment Processing
- Prepare and process payments (e.g., checks, electronic transfers) to vendors.
- Ensure timely payment of invoices to avoid late fees or disruptions in services.
- Reconcile payments with vendor statements to ensure accuracy.
3. Vendor Management
- Maintain vendor records and ensure they are up to date.
- Communicate with vendors regarding payment inquiries or discrepancies.
4. Expense Reporting
- Review and process employee expense reports.
- Ensure compliance with company expense policies and guidelines.
- Reconcile expense reports with supporting documentation.
5. Account Reconciliation
- Reconcile accounts payable transactions with general ledger accounts and resolve discrepancies between accounts payable records and general ledger
6. Financial Reporting
- Generate reports related to accounts payable for management review
- Provide analysis of accounts payable data to support decision-making processes
- Provide support and information for forecasting activities
7. Compliance and Audit
- Ensure compliance with company polic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ements.
- Assist with internal and external audits by providing requested documentation and explanations.
8. Process Improvement
- Identify opportunities to streamline accounts payable processes and improve efficiency.
- Implement best practices and automation tools to optimize workflow.
9.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Collaborate with other departments such as finance and procurement to resolve issues and improve processes.
10. Team Leadership and Training
- Provide guidance and support to junior staff in accounts payable team.
- Assist manager to oversee day-to-day operations of the department.
